Definition
Way of thinking, or an idea, thought, or opinion.
- way of thinking; mindset; perspective
- idea; thought; opinion
colloquialpeoplecommunication
How it's used
Refers specifically to a person's perspective or opinion on a particular issue rather than the general cognitive process of thinking. It is frequently used when asking for someone's take on a situation or when critiquing a proposed plan. It carries a slightly more personal or subjective nuance compared to the more formal concept of a viewpoint.

Common mistake
Learners often confuse it with the verb 諗, which means to think. Remember that 諗法 is a noun representing the result or the style of thinking, so it should not be used as a verb to describe the act of pondering.
